Important: This is an onsite position in Twin Falls, Idaho. Remote work is not available.

Opportunity: Inside Sales Representative - Full Time, Flexible Schedule

Seastrom Manufacturing is looking for a friendly, enthusiastic, and team-oriented individual who is motivated to promote and sell high-quality custom and standard catalog parts. The Inside Sales Representative will develop and maintain respectful customer relationships and will manage the quoting and sales process from beginning to end. The Inside Sales Representative may also periodically make direct sales contact in person and represent the company at promotional events, such as trade shows and corporate purchasing and engineering symposiums.

This position requires the ability to consistently follow processes and schedules independently, with periodic interaction with managers and others. The ideal candidate will be a team-oriented individual who possesses a strong personal value commitment dedicated to professionalism, problem solving, and adaptability.
